2015 Was a Warm, Wild Year. What’s Next?
2015 saw things heat up and get out of hand, and not just in politics.
A record warm December raised average temperatures enough to make 2015 the second hottest year on record in the United States, according to the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ration's National Climate Monitoring Annual Report,
which was released Thursday.
The United Nations had previously reported that 2015 was shaping up to be the warmest year on record for the whole planet.
Last year was also the third wettest on record in the U.S. and saw ten weather- or climate-related disasters that each caused at least $1 billion in damage in the U.S. and killed a total of 155 people. These include a drought, two floods, five severe storms, a wildfire, and a winter storm.
The average U.S. temperature was 54.4°F, 2.4°F above the 20th century average, and second only to 2012's record warmth. This was also the 19th year with average temperatures above the average for the century.
Every state reported above-average annual temperatures. The warming was particularly obvious across most of the eastern half of the country in December, when many places saw temperatures 30 degrees above normal and many records were set.
This mirrored changes seen in the Arctic that month, when temperatures rise sharply to 50 degrees above normal. Part of this warming was driven by a strong El Niño, or periodic warming in the Pacific Ocean, but some of it can also be attributed to global warming, says meteorologist Eric Holthaus, who was not involved with the federal report.
The analysis comes less than a month after the U.S. and 194 other countries signed an agreement in Paris to more aggressively counter the effects of climate change. “Even if all the initial targets in Paris are met, we’ll only be part of the way there when it comes to reducing carbon from the atmosphere,” said President Barack Obama at the time. Still, the agreement represented “a turning point” by setting up “the architecture" for doing so, he said.
NOAA's climate monitoring center doesn't issue predictions for future weather, but the agency's Climate Prediction Center does. That team's forecast for the next three months calls for warmer-than-average temperatures in much of the country, although parts of Texas and the Southeast may be a little cooler than usual. As Lancaster University Professor Gail Whiteman told the Weather Channel, "climate change means extreme weather is the new normal."

A few things to consider before booking a flight:
With fuel costs rising and airlines finding more fees to impose on travelers every day, airfare isn’t getting any cheaper. Since you can’t drive to all your dream destinations, flying is the only way to go sometimes and, undeniably, the fastest. Luckily, there are plenty of ways to find the most affordable fares and also avoid paying as many extra charges as possible when you plan ahead.
Getting the best fare
Airlines put out their fare sales on Tuesday morning, making this day the best day to book a flight for less.
Fly during the least popular times.
Tuesday, Wednesday and Saturday are the slowest days to fly, which means cheaper deals than the rest of the week. You can also find reduced rates on early morning flights, since many people don’t like to get up before the sun to get to the airport. Earlier boarding times can also considerably cut down your chances of getting bumped on an overbooked flight or delayed because of other delayed flights or mechanical issues.
Choose your seat later.
Some airlines charge you to pick your seat when you book online, adding even more to the bottom line of your ticket cost. If you show up early on your travel day, you can still get suitable seats. Some of the best seats get held back until flight day, unless others are willing to pay extra for them ahead of time, so you still have the chance at one of those.
Fly on holidays.
You already know that summer is the most expensive time to fly, and even though most other times are more affordable, the days surrounding holidays can be crazy. Save big if you’re willing to travel on major holidays, such as Thanksgiving and Christmas.
Don’t wait until the last-minute to book.
Many travelers don’t know that there’s a sweet spot for booking and getting
the best price on your tickets. Book too early or too late and you could end up paying more than you need to. The best time to book is between three months and six weeks from when you want to travel.
Avoiding extra fees
Airlines will charge for just about anything these days. Some have even toyed around with charging customers for using the restroom. All those extra fees can certainly add up, but there’s no reason to pay them if you don’t have to. Here are some tips to keep money in your wallet once you get to the airport.

The relationship between exercise and cancer has long puzzled experts.
Exercise is strongly associated with lowered risks for many types of cancer. People who regularly exercise generally prove to be much less likely to develop or die from the disease than people who do not. At the same time, exercise involves biological stress, which typically leads to a short-term increase in inflammation(炎症) throughout the body. Inflammation can contribute to higher risks for many cancers. Now, a new study in mice may offer some clues into the relationship between exercise and cancer. It suggests that exercise may change how the immune system deals with cancer by boosting certain immune cells and other chemicals that, together, can relieve cancer or fight it off altogether.
To try to better understand how exercise can protect the body against cancer, scientists at the University of Copenhagen in Denmark and other institutions decided
to closely examine what happens inside mice at high risk for the disease.
The scientists first implanted skin cancer cells into the mice before providing half of them with running wheels in their cages while the other animals nothing. After four weeks, far fewer of the runners had increased the cancer cells than the sitting animals and those that had been diagnosed with the disease showed fewer and smaller damage.
In a way, running seemed to be helpful in fighting against the cancer.
Next, the scientists undertook the far more challenging task of making the process backward. To start, they drew blood from both the runners and sitting animals and cancer cells in both groups. Then they looked at how the various samples were different.
As expected, they found much higher levels of the beneficial chemicals in the blood of the exercising animals, especially right after they had been working out on the wheels but also at other times of the day.
So the scientists repeated their original experiment multiple times. But in some of these follow-up experiments, they injected the runners with a substance that blocked the production of beneficial chemicals and gave sitting animals large doses of added chemicals.
Then they again looked at the animals’ blood and other cells.
What they now saw was that when running mice could not produce certain chemicals, they developed cancer at the same rate as the sitting animals, while the sitting animals that had been injected with extra chemicals fought off their cancer better than other sitting mice.
With these results, “we show that voluntary wheel running in mice can reduce the growth of cancer” said Pernille Hojman, a researcher at the University of Copenhagen who oversaw the new study.
“But mice, obviously, are not people, and it is impossible to know from this study whether a similar process occurs in humans. ”Dr. Hojman said.

My mom only had one eye. I hated her„ she was such an embarrassment.
I remember that it was field day, and my mom came. I was so embarrassed that I threw her a hateful look and ran out. The next day at school„ “Your mom only has one eye?!” and they laugh at me.
I wished that my mom would just disappear from this world so I said to my mom, “Mom, why don’t you have the other eye?! You’re only going to make me a laughingstock. Why don’t you just die?” My mom did not respond.
That night„ I woke up, and went to the kitchen to get a glass of water. My mom was crying there, so quietly, as if she was afraid that she might wake me. I took a look at her, and then turned away. I told myself that I would grow up and become successful, because I hated my one-eyed mom and our desperate poverty.
Then I studied really hard. I left my mother and came to Seoul and studied, and got accepted in the Seoul University with all the confidence I had. Then, I got married. I bought a house of my own. Then I had kids, too. Now I’m living happily as a successful man. I like it here because it’s a place that doesn’t remind me of my mom.
This happiness was getting bigger and bigger, when someone unexpected came to see me. It was my mother„ Still with her one eye. It felt as if the whole sky was falling apart on me. My little girl ran away, scared of my mom’s eye.
And I asked her, “Who are you? I don’t know you!!” as if I tried to make that real. I screamed at her “How dare you come to my house and scare my daughter! Get out of here now!!” And to this, my mother quietly answered, “oh, I’m so sorry. I may have gotten the wrong address,” and she disappeared. Thank goodness„ she doesn’t recognize me. I was quite relieved. I told myself that I wasn’t going to care, or think about this for the rest of my life.
One day, however, a letter regarding a school reunion came to my house. I lied to my wife saying that I was going on a business trip. After the reunion, I went down to the poor house, that I used to call a home„just out of curiosity there, I found my mother fallen on the cold ground. But I did not flow off a single tear. She had a piece of paper in her hand„. it was a letter to me.
She wrote:
My son, I think my life has been long enough now. And„ I won’t visit Seoul anymore„ but would it be too much to ask if I wanted you to come visit me once in a while? I miss you so much. And I was so glad when I heard you were coming for the reunion. But I decided not to go to the school„. For you„ I’m sorry that I only have one eye, and I was an embarrassment for you. You see, when you were very little, you got into an accident, and lost your eye. As a mother, I couldn’t stand watching
you having to grow up with only one eye„ so I gave you mine„ I was so proud of my son that was seeing a whole new world for me, in my place, with that eye. I was never upset at you for anything you did. The couple times that you were angry with me. I thought to myself, ‘it’s because he loves me.’ I miss the times when you were still young around me. I miss you so much. I love you. You mean the world to me.
My World is falling down. I hated the person who only lived for me . I cried for My Mother, I didn’t know of any way that will make up for my worst deeds„
